1,100 Marijuana Plants Found in Idaho Corn Field

1,100 Marijuana Plants Found in Idaho Corn Field

Idaho State Police investigators uprooted about 1,100 marijuana plants growing in a corn field with an estimated street value of $2.2 million. Read more at The Sacramento Bee.
